Richard D. Winters (January 21, 1918) is a former United States Army officer and decorated war hero. He commanded Company “E” of the 2nd Battalion, 506th Parachute Infantry Regiment, 101st Airborne Division, during World War II. The unit – also known as “Easy Company” per the contemporary Joint Army/Navy Phonetic Alphabet - parachuted into Normandy in the early hours of D-Day, and fought across France, Belgium, the Netherlands, and eventually into Germany.
